HOW JAGUAR RACE VEHICLES CAN BECOME OBJECTS OF SEXUAL DESIRE FOR SOME PEOPLE

The automobile is an object of intense fascination for many people around the world. It represents freedom, power, status, individualism, and achievement, among other things. But it also holds a deeper meaning that extends beyond its practical purpose as a means of transportation. In psychology, cars can be seen as objects of desire and eroticism. This can be especially true when it comes to certain models, which are designed to attract attention through their sleek lines and muscular appearance. Jaguar race vehicles are one such example. The company has been known for producing some of the most sensual cars on the market, and their designers have gone to great lengths to make them look like objects of fantasy.

According to psychoanalytic theory, form-based fetishism is a type of sexual attraction that involves an obsession with specific physical features of another person or object. These may include legs, breasts, buttocks, hair, feet, clothes, or even car parts. For those who experience this kind of arousal, the object itself becomes a source of pleasure and satisfaction in and of itself, rather than being just a means to an end. When it comes to Jaguar race vehicles, the fetishistic focus may be on the shape and curves of the body, the color of the paint job, or the sound of the engine.

In neuropsychological terms, form-based fetishism is thought to involve activation of the brain's reward system. Specifically, areas of the prefrontal cortex and striatum are activated by visual cues associated with the fetish object, leading to feelings of pleasure and excitement. This response is similar to what happens during normal sexual arousal, where dopamine and other neurotransmitters are released into the brain.

Fetishists may become fixated on certain features that are not traditionally seen as sexually attractive, such as the hood of a car or its wheels.

But why do some people develop these kinds of fetishes? There is no single answer to this question, but it may have something to do with early childhood experiences. Some research suggests that exposure to certain stimuli at a young age can lead to a fixation on particular shapes or colors later in life. In addition, cultural factors may play a role, as certain societies place more emphasis on certain physical characteristics over others.

Despite their psychological underpinnings, fetish objects like Jaguar race vehicles can provide immense pleasure and satisfaction for those who experience them. They allow individuals to explore their desires in a safe and non-threatening way, without fear of judgment or shame. And while they may seem unusual or even deviant to outsiders, they offer a window into the complex workings of the human mind and the power of desire.
